Tldr for my Ayaka so far:

C0: Very good. More consistent DPS and much better cryo synergy/application than Eula, although Eula's burst does dramatically outscale Ayaka's.

C1: Really doesn't add much, which is surprising because mathematically it looks like it should. My Ayaka's E can crit for like 40k damage so it's nice to have available more often, plus it regenerates energy, but I find that using her E more frequently clashes with her need to use her dash to reapply cryo.

C2: Quite a large increase in overall damage from her Q. Being much wider, she becomes significantly more useful on floors with a lot of enemies, but more importantly, she takes down single target bosses much faster.

If I had to choose between C3 Eula and C2 Ayaka, honestly it boils down to a couple of things:

Eula seems deliberately designed to be a hyperinvest speed clear character in the Abyss. To that end, she's very nearly the best character in the entire game for that one niche. But she falls apart in endurance fights because her DPS is highly inconsistent due to her need to keep up several different buffs simultaneously.

Ayaka honestly reminds me of a combination of Keqing and Diluc. Her main attack DPS is pretty good but her charged attacks are much stronger than her normals. Combined with her need to dash to apply weapon cryo, she's a bit stamina starved. Her Q charges much faster than Eula's but does less damage in most situations. That said, her burst can also trigger elemental reactions, unlike Eula's.

Eula is better if you hyperinvest her and you're interested mainly in fast Abyss clears.
Ayaka is a better main carry DPS overall.

Bits were meaningless. N64 graphically was a lot more powerful than PlayStation but was hamstrung so badly by the cartridge format. It was like 1,000x the production cost for 1/10th the storage space (and that's for the rare 512 Megabit (64 MB) cartridges. Most games were 32 MB or smaller. Mario 64 was 8 MB.

A standard CD was 650 MB and cost like 5 cents to make
